Go through the detailed guide on how to Validate Initial Offer Letter electronically with pdfFiller:
Upload the document you need to sign to pdfFiller from your device or cloud storage.
Once the document opens in the editor, hit Sign in the top toolbar.
Generate your electronic signature by typing, drawing, or importing your handwritten signature's photo from your device. Then, click Save and sign.
Click anywhere on a document to Validate Initial Offer Letter. You can drag it around or resize it using the controls in the hovering panel. To use your signature, click OK.
Complete the signing process by clicking DONE below your document or in the top right corner.
Next, you'll go back to the pdfFiller dashboard. From there, you can get a signed copy, print the document, or send it to other parties for review or validation.
